matlab中圆周率怎么表示
时间: 2023-12-06 16:06:28 浏览: 281
在MATLAB中,圆周率可以使用预定义的常量 `pi` 来表示。例如,要计算一个半径为3的圆的周长,可以使用以下代码:
```
r = 3;
circumference = 2 * pi * r;
```
这里,`pi` 是一个代表圆周率的常量,`r` 是半径。通过使用 `2 * pi`,可以计算出圆的周长。
相关问题
matlab中的圆周率
在 MATLAB 中,圆周率可以通过内置的常数 `pi` 来表示。`pi` 是一个可以直接使用的预定义常数,它的值约等于 3.14159。你可以在 MATLAB 命令行中输入 `pi` 来获取圆周率的值。
此外,MATLAB 还提供了一些计算圆周率的函数,例如 `circumference` 可以用来计算圆的周长。这个函数需要指定圆的半径作为输入参数,并返回计算得到的周长。具体使用方式如下:
```matlab
r = 1; % 设置圆的半径为1
circumference = 2 * pi * r; % 计算圆的周长
```
辛普森积分matlab求圆周率
可以辛普森积分来计算圆周率的值,具体步骤如下:
1. 定义函数:定义一个函数 f(x) = 4 / (1 + x^2),其中 x 的范围为 [0, 1]。
2. 使用辛普森积分计算圆周率:在 Matlab 中,使用 `integral` 函数可以实现积分计算,代码如下:
```
f = @(x) 4 ./ (1 + x.^2);
pi_approx = integral(f, 0, 1, 'Method', 'Simpson');
```
其中,`integral` 函数的第一个参数是需要积分的函数,第二个参数是积分下限,第三个参数是积分上限。`'Method', 'Simpson'` 表示使用辛普森积分方法计算积分值。
3. 输出结果:输出圆周率的近似值:
```
disp(pi_approx);
```
这样就可以得到圆周率的近似值了。
阅读全文